Yes. > *Blueprint Cleanup* > > As I mentioned in my previous email, I've now obsoleted all blueprints > not targetted to folsom. The blueprint system has been used for "feature > requests", and I don't think it is working because there is no one > grabbing unassigned blueprints. I think it has to be up to the drafter > of the blueprint to find a person/team to actually implement the > blueprint or it will just sit there. Therefore I've removed all of the > "good idea" blueprints. This was kind of sad, because there were some > really good ideas there. We discussed for quite some time that "wishlist" bugs that don't get worked on for some time should be closed as "Opinion/Wishlist"... and use that search to get a nice list of "things that sound like a good idea but nobody has had time to work on".
